AGF Management Ltd. decreased its stake in shares of NIKE, Inc. (NYSE:NKE – Free Report) by 95.6%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 39,514 shares of the footwear maker’s stock after selling 851,798 shares during the period. AGF Management Ltd.’s holdings in NIKE were worth $2,990,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

NIKE Profile
NIKE,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, markets, and sells athletic footwear, apparel, equipment, accessories, and services worldwide. The company provides athletic and casual footwear, apparel, and accessories under the Jumpman trademark; and casual sneakers, apparel, and accessories under the Converse, Chuck Taylor, All Star, One Star, Star Chevron, and Jack Purcell trademarks.
